Discomfort and Discomfort Throughout Surgical treatment



Many individuals often are afraid experiencing substantial pain and discomfort throughout cataract surgical treatment. Nonetheless, it's necessary to comprehend that cataract surgical treatment is generally pain-free. Your eye will certainly be numbed with anesthetic, guaranteeing you will not feel any type of pain during the treatment. The eye doctor may likewise offer you with a light sedative to assist you kick back.




During the surgical treatment, you might experience some pressure or light feelings, yet these are generally not agonizing. The entire process fasts, generally lasting around 15-20 minutes per eye. The specialist will guide you via each action, guaranteeing you really feel comfortable and notified throughout the surgical procedure.

After the treatment, you might experience small discomfort or itching in the eye, however this is typical and need to diminish within a day or more. If you experience any type of extreme pain or sudden changes in vision, be sure to call your ophthalmologist immediately. Healing Time and Visual Outcomes



If you've gone through cataract surgical treatment, you may wonder regarding the healing time and what visual outcomes to expect. Complying with cataract surgical treatment, the healing period is usually fast, with numerous patients experiencing boosted vision within a few days. Initially, you might have some moderate discomfort, watering of the eyes, and sensitivity to light, yet these signs usually diminish swiftly. It's important to follow your ophthalmologist's post-operative directions thoroughly to ensure a smooth recuperation process.

In terms of aesthetic end results, cataract surgical procedure is very successful in bring back clear vision. Numerous patients report a substantial enhancement in their vision post-surgery, with shades appearing brighter and things appearing sharper and a lot more concentrated. Most of individuals attain their preferred visual acuity after the treatment, enabling them to resume their day-to-day activities without the barrier of cataracts.
